GERMANY NAVY ORDERS DIVER SONARS FOR EOD USE

Non-Magnetic sonars are used for mine clearance and salvage


RJE International has delivered twenty-five DLS-2A diver operated sonars to the Germany Navy through a contact from J.Bornhoeft Industriegeraete. These sonars meet the Germany Navy requirement for mine recovery and subsea salvage by military divers. Used by the Explosive Ordinance Disposal (EOD) Divers, the DLS-2A is a non-magnetic diver operated sonar that allows the operator to locate objects as small as a 12 inch cylinder up to 120 yards away. In addition, the DLS-2A has a passive mode that facilitates the recovery of acoustic beacons, similar to the ones used on aircraft “Black Boxes”. Military divers all around the world use the DLS-2A to keep harbors and waterways free of mines. With hundreds in service worldwide, the DLS-2A and DLS-1 trainer sonar are the most commonly used diver sonars in the world.
